试想这样一个系统:处理器通过可配置硬件(本质上是一个硬件包裹)与其内存和外设连接——这就抽象了处理器的接口。简单地对FPGA重新编程就改变了硬件包裹,系统设计师可以轻易地改变处理器内核,甚至在硬的或软的处理器之间...
大概可以分为主串、主并、从串、从并、JTAG模式等等。很简单,FPGA主动控制的配置就是主,外部CPU控制的配置就是从,串并你懂的,就是串行还是并行数据进去。JTAG是标准的,CPLD/FPGA都支持的,也可以配置。配置流程要去...
由于你的问题很模糊,我的理解,就是你想自己做一个下载FPGA的程序(如CPU配置FPGA),给出的这一个例子可以参考,如果使用Xilinx或Lattice的器件,配置方式略有差异,主要还是HEX文件的问题,datasheet上对于这部分的描述相对...
一、Preloader和Uboot(新手不要作如何修改)。二、可以是硬核(称hps)先启动然后配置FPGA,还有其它启动方式;在这里我们以hps先启动做例子。主要需要有3个文件,<1>Linux镜像zImage,<2>设备树文件dtb,<3>FPGA配置文件...
一般CPU也就是指的单片机MCU之类的,MCU的优势是能够很好很容易的设计大型的,复杂的控制流程项目。而FPGA主要实现接口之类的模块,或者针对某一算法而用它实现高速电路。一般用这两种配合实现大型项目,CPU控制,FPGA接口或者...
fpga是现场可编程门阵列,内部以LUT查找表为核心。用户买来的fpga一般是一块空的芯片,不具备任何功能。用户可以使用多种方法(如编程、原理图等)将fpga配置成具有特定功能的专用芯片。而cpu指的是具有计算和控制功能的处理...
当然可以。现在的FPGA主频都快上G了,40M属于小case!但是,一般不用FPGA直接产生,有很多分立器件可以单独实现波形输出,设计更为灵活。
推荐配置:CPU:INTER酷睿i7-2600K,超至4.5G¥2000左右主板:华擎费特拉提Z68¥1100左右内存:海盗船复仇者8GB1600DDR3单条X2¥550左右硬盘:三星830SSD128GB(系统盘)¥650左右希捷...
在使用方案上增加如增加认证功能等
当然了!!!如果够牛的话,写一段verilog程序,综合一下,FPGA就可以当CPU来用了。现在很多FPGA的厂家都提供这样的软核,还可以根据你的需要来定制,例如Altera系列的FPGA,很多支持NIOS软核。但目前实际应用中,这么用的人...